In today’s fast-paced and competitive business world, organizations are constantly striving to enhance the performance and productivity of their employees. One valuable tool that has been gaining popularity in recent years is 360 feedback services. This powerful tool provides a comprehensive view of an individual’s performance by soliciting feedback from multiple sources, including peers, supervisors, subordinates, and even customers. This holistic approach allows individuals to gain a better understanding of their strengths and weaknesses, and provides valuable insights for professional development.
360 feedback services offer a unique perspective on individual performance by collecting feedback from a variety of sources. This multi-dimensional feedback helps to identify blind spots and areas for improvement that may not be apparent through traditional performance evaluations. By gathering feedback from colleagues at different levels within the organization, as well as external stakeholders, 360 feedback services provide a well-rounded picture of an individual’s performance.
One of the key benefits of 360 feedback services is the opportunity for individuals to receive feedback from multiple perspectives. This comprehensive view helps individuals gain a better understanding of how their actions and behaviors are perceived by others. By receiving feedback from a variety of sources, individuals can identify patterns and common themes in the feedback, allowing them to develop a more accurate self-awareness and make targeted improvements to their performance.
Another important benefit of 360 feedback services is the opportunity for individuals to receive feedback on a wide range of competencies and behaviors. Traditional performance evaluations often focus on specific job-related skills, while 360 feedback services provide feedback on a broader set of competencies, such as communication, leadership, teamwork, and interpersonal skills. This comprehensive feedback allows individuals to identify areas for improvement across a range of competencies, leading to overall professional growth and development.

Implementing 360 feedback services in an organization requires careful planning and communication. It is important to establish clear goals and objectives for the feedback process, and to communicate these to all participants. Additionally, organizations should provide training and support for individuals participating in the feedback process, to ensure that they understand the purpose and benefits of 360 feedback services.
It is also important to ensure that feedback is delivered in a constructive and respectful manner. Feedback should be specific, actionable, and focused on behaviors rather than personal characteristics. By providing feedback in a constructive way, organizations can help individuals to understand and act on the feedback, leading to meaningful improvements in performance.
